Authorized Payment Locations for Frontier Bills

Frontier partners with several nationwide payment networks to make in-person payments convenient. Here are the main places where you can pay your bill:

Western Union Locations

Western Union agents can be found in various retail establishments including:

  • Supermarkets
  • Check cashing stores
  • Convenience stores
  • Some pharmacies

CheckFreePay Locations

CheckFreePay services are available at retailers like:

  • Walmart stores
  • Kroger stores
  • Kmart locations
  • Various other retail chains

MoneyGram Locations

MoneyGram payment services can be found at:

  • Grocery stores
  • Convenience stores
  • Some financial service centers

Other Common Retail Locations

Many other retailers may accept Frontier bill payments, including:

  • Local convenience stores
  • Grocery chains
  • Pharmacies like CVS or Walgreens

What You Need to Pay Your Bill In Person

When heading out to pay your Frontier bill, make sure you bring:

  1. Your Frontier bill – This contains your account number and amount due
  2. Acceptable payment method – Cash, check, or money order (most locations don’t accept credit/debit cards for bill payments)
  3. Service fee amount – Usually $1.50 extra for in-person payments
  4. Valid ID – Some locations may require identification

Step-by-Step Process for In-Person Payments

The actual payment process is pretty straightforward:

  1. Find and visit an authorized payment location near you
  2. Inform the clerk you want to pay your Frontier bill
  3. Provide your Frontier account number from your bill
  4. Make your payment (cash, check, or money order)
  5. Wait for the clerk to process the transaction
  6. Collect your receipt as proof of payment

Your payment typically posts to your Frontier account within one business day. I recommend keeping that receipt until you see the payment reflected in your account.

Fees for In-Person Payments

When paying your Frontier bill in person, you should expect to pay a small convenience fee. Currently, this fee is:

$1.50 per transaction

While this might seem annoying, it’s actually cheaper than some other payment options. For instance, paying by phone with a Frontier agent can cost up to $10! The $1.50 fee is quite reasonable considering the convenience of making a cash payment at a nearby store.

Alternative Ways to Pay Your Frontier Bill

In-person payments aren’t your only option. Frontier offers several other methods that might be more convenient depending on your situation:

Auto Pay

  • No fees
  • Automatic recurring payments
  • Can use bank account or credit card
  • Set up online or through the MyFrontier app

Online Payments

  • No fees
  • Pay through frontier.com after signing in
  • Use debit/credit card or bank account
  • Available 24/7

Express Pay

  • No fees
  • One-time payment without signing in
  • Just need account number and email/ZIP code

MyFrontier App

  • No fees
  • Convenient mobile payments
  • Available for iOS and Android
  • Manage account on the go

Phone Payments

  • Free with automated system (800-917-7489)
  • $10 fee if paying with agent assistance (1-800-921-8102)
  • Use bank account, debit, or credit card
  • Immediate posting to account

Mail Payments

  • No fees
  • Send check/money order to:
    Frontier
    PO Box 740407
    Cincinnati, OH 45274-0407
  • Include your 17-digit account number
  • Allow 7-10 days for processing

Benefits of Going Paperless

While we’re focused on in-person payments, it’s worth mentioning that Frontier now charges a Printed Bill fee for most customers. To avoid this fee, you can enroll in paperless billing:

  1. Sign into your Frontier account
  2. Select “My Billing” from the dropdown menu
  3. Find “Paperless Billing is off”
  4. Click “Enroll in Paperless”
  5. Confirm by selecting “OK”

Paperless billing is environmentally friendly and organizes all your bills in one convenient digital location.

Common Questions About In-Person Frontier Payments

Can I pay with a credit card in person?

Most in-person payment locations only accept cash, check, or money order for bill payments. Credit/debit cards are typically not accepted for this purpose.

How quickly will my payment post?

Payments usually post to your Frontier account within one business day, though sometimes it happens immediately.

What if I lose my receipt?

Always keep your receipt until the payment shows on your account. If you lose it, contact the payment location first, then Frontier customer service if needed.

Can someone else pay my bill for me?

Yes, another person can pay your bill as long as they have your bill or account number.

Is there a limit to how much I can pay?

There’s typically no limit on bill payments, but some locations might have cash handling restrictions.
